Australian Travel Startup Travello Set to be Acquired by US-Based TWAI
Australian-owned travel tech startup Travello is reportedly in the final stages of being acquired by TWAI, a US-based travel technology company. This potential acquisition signals a significant move within the travel industry, highlighting the continued globalization and consolidation of travel technology providers. Travello, known for its platform connecting travelers and facilitating in-destination experiences, would be joining TWAI’s portfolio if the deal finalizes.
While details surrounding the acquisition remain confidential, the move is expected to bolster TWAI’s presence in the Australian and broader Asia-Pacific markets. For Travello, it potentially provides access to greater resources, expanded technological capabilities, and a wider global reach.
